2. Important Safety Information

Adhere to the following safety guidelines during installation and operation:

  • The gauge is not waterproof. Avoid installing it in locations exposed to water or snow.
  • Ensure the gauge is securely mounted using the provided brackets and thumbscrews to prevent it from becoming loose during vehicle operation.
  • Route wiring harnesses carefully to avoid chafing or undue strain.
  • Secure wiring to the vehicle with wire ties. Pay special attention to sensor harness routing beneath the vehicle and in the engine compartment.
  • Take care when routing the sensor harness near hot exhaust components.
  • Apply strain reliefs and wire coverings as necessary.
  • Use a 5A inline fuse on the switched 12V power supply line (Pin 1-Power/IO).
  • Avoid cutting or extending the sensor harness.
  • Use appropriate gauge wire (20 AWG or thicker) when extending wires, especially Pins 1 (Switched 12V) or 2 (Ground) of the Power/IO harness.
  • Ensure all connections are secure and insulated from shorts to adjacent wires and the vehicle structure.

3. Product Specifications

The Geloo X Series 30-0300 Wideband UEGO Air Fuel Ratio Gauge features the following specifications:

FeatureSpecification
Product NameWideband UEGO Air/Fuel Ratio Gauge Kit
Gauge Size52mm (2-1/16 inch) outer diameter mounting
Analog Output0-5V
OutputRS-232
Range8.0:1 to 20.0:1 AFR / 0.55 to 2.00 Lambda
PrecisionConfigurable 3 or 4 digit precision display model
VoltagesSupport vehicle/system voltages up to 16V
MaterialPlastic
Product Dimensions5.51 x 5.11 x 4.52 inches
Item Weight1.28 Pounds

4. Installation

4.1 Mounting the Gauge

The 52mm (2-1/16 inch) wideband gauge housing is designed to fit easily into most instrument pods. Use the supplied brackets and thumbscrews to securely mount the gauge. Ensure the mounting location is not exposed to water or snow.

4.2 Wiring Instructions

The gauge is supplied with a Power/IO (A) and a UEGO/IO (B) harness. The sensor harness needs to be routed to the UEGO sensor, while the Power/IO harness integrates into the vehicle's electrical system. The gauge requires a minimum power of 12V and ground.

  • Connector A - Power/IO:
    • Pin 1: Red (12V Power)
    • Pin 2: Black (Ground)
    • Pin 3: Green (CANL)
    • Pin 4: White (CANH)
    • Pin 5: Blue (RS-232 Output)
    • Pin 6-8: Not Used
    • Pin 9: White (0-5V Analog Output +)
    • Pin 10: Brown (0-5V Analog Output -)
  • Connector B - Bosch LSU4.9 UEGO Sensor:
    • Pin 1: Green (Trim Resistor)
    • Pin 2: White (Heater Negative-)
    • Pin 3: Orange (COM)
    • Pin 4: Not Used
    • Pin 5: Red (Pump Current)
    • Pin 6: Black (Sense)
    • Pin 7: Not Used
    • Pin 8: Brown (Heater Positive+)

5. Operation

The gauge features two buttons on the front of the dashboard: MODE (mode switch key) and SEL (select key). These buttons allow you to navigate menus and configure various display options.

5.1 Button Functions

  • MODE Button: Used to switch between different display modes and settings.
  • SEL Button: Used to select options or confirm settings within a mode.

5.2 Available Options and Functions

The following options are accessible via the MODE and SEL buttons:

  • 3 DIG: Change to 3-digit display mode (e.g., 12.4).
  • 4 DIG: Change to 4-digit display mode (e.g., 12.43).
  • ACAL: Perform a free air calibration. The sensor must be removed from the exhaust for this procedure.
  • rCAL: Change to resistor trim calibration mode.
  • AFR: Change to Air Fuel Ratio (AFR) display mode (e.g., 14.65 AFR = 1.00 Lambda).
  • LA: Change to Lambda display mode.
  • O2: Change to Oxygen % display mode. Rich mixtures are displayed as 0.0.
  • CAN: Change CAN message ID.

6. Maintenance

To ensure the longevity and accurate performance of your Geloo Wideband UEGO Air Fuel Ratio Gauge, follow these maintenance guidelines:

  • Keep the gauge clean and free from dust and debris. Use a soft, dry cloth for cleaning.
  • Avoid exposing the gauge to excessive moisture or direct water spray, as it is not waterproof.
  • Regularly inspect all wiring connections for tightness and signs of wear or damage.
  • Ensure the sensor harness is not chafing against any vehicle components, especially hot exhaust parts.
  • Free air calibration is not required when used with this Wideband O2 UEGO AFR gauge, simplifying maintenance.

7. Troubleshooting

This section addresses common issues you might encounter with your Geloo Wideband UEGO Air Fuel Ratio Gauge.

7.1 Display Issues

  • Symptom: Gauge display shows all lights illuminated, but no clear AFR reading.
  • Possible Cause: Internal display component malfunction or intermittent connection.
  • Action:
    1. Verify all power and ground connections are secure and properly insulated.
    2. Ensure the PWR/IO cable and sensor cable are firmly connected to the gauge.
    3. If the issue persists, contact customer support for further assistance.

7.2 Inaccurate Readings

  • Symptom: AFR readings appear inconsistent or incorrect.
  • Possible Cause: Sensor malfunction, improper wiring, or exhaust leak near the sensor.
  • Action:
    1. Inspect the UEGO sensor for any physical damage or contamination.
    2. Check the sensor cable for proper connection and integrity.
    3. Ensure there are no exhaust leaks near the sensor bung.
    4. If necessary, perform a free air calibration (ACAL) as described in the Operation section, ensuring the sensor is removed from the exhaust.
